The NudgeWorks job runs nightly and queues appointment reminders for all Brightfern clinics. If it stalls, it's almost always the template renderer choking on a malformed locale string — check the dead-letter queue first. Re-running the job is safe; it's idempotent and won't double-text patients. Don't bump the batch size past 500 without talking to the scheduling crew, since the upstream gateway throttles hard. Everything else, including restart commands and the escalation rota, is documented on the wiki page linked below.

runbook for badug-kadup: https://confluence.zemvarlabs.internal/projects/browse/display/projects/bd1b

Re: Retirement of the Stonebriar product line

Stonebriar sales have declined for five consecutive quarters and support costs now exceed contribution margin. The retirement plan is staged: new orders close end of Q2, existing contracts honoured through their terms, and spares stocked for twenty-four months. Sales leads should steer prospects toward the Ashgrove range; migration incentives are already approved. Customer comms are drafted and awaiting legal sign-off. The forward strategy behind this decision is set out in the note below.

confidential, yafog-hagug: Gross margin on Druix came in at 10 percent against a plan of 15 percent. Only 5 of the 80 pilot accounts renewed Druix, so a churn review is set for October 1.

Excerpt from the Switchgrass assignment service design, shared so support can explain experiment behavior. Assignment is deterministic: a user's bucket is computed from a stable hash of their account, so reinstalling the app does not change their variant. Assignments are cached client-side and refreshed periodically; forced refreshes are rate-limited to protect the service. If a customer reports seeing two variants, check cache staleness before escalating. The caching and rate-limit constants currently in effect are listed below.

tuning table, kajog-bawip:
TIERS = {
    "kelius": 256,
    "lammir": 543,
}